我想使用Innosetup创建一个安装程序,它不应该使用Windows安装程序注册该应用程序,我可以在Advanced Installer中看到它。 如果选择此选项,则安装程序不会将任何值写入注册表,也不会出现在“添加/删除程序”中,只是将文件复制到所需位置。
创建便携式应用程序需要此功能
它只是作为一个提取器。
您可以在下面的链接中看到使用NSIS脚本构建的示例便携式应用程序。 http://www.megaupload.com/?d=NG01KLPL
我想使用Innosetup创建一个安装程序,它不应该使用Windows安装程序注册该应用程序,我可以在Advanced Installer中看到它。 如果选择此选项,则安装程序不会将任何值写入注册表,也不会出现在“添加/删除程序”中,只是将文件复制到所需位置。
创建便携式应用程序需要此功能
它只是作为一个提取器。
您可以在下面的链接中看到使用NSIS脚本构建的示例便携式应用程序。 http://www.megaupload.com/?d=NG01KLPL
你也可以设置 CreateUninstallRegKey=no 仅阻止添加/删除程序中的条目,或 Uninstallable=no 禁用所有卸载功能。
这两种都有副作用,如停止 UsePrevious* 价值和 Get/SetPreviousdata。
请注意,添加/删除程序不是Windows Installer,它是一种与Inno不同的技术和替代方案。
你也可以设置 CreateUninstallRegKey=no 仅阻止添加/删除程序中的条目,或 Uninstallable=no 禁用所有卸载功能。
这两种都有副作用,如停止 UsePrevious* 价值和 Get/SetPreviousdata。
请注意,添加/删除程序不是Windows Installer,它是一种与Inno不同的技术和替代方案。